The Two That Actually Let You In

Lottoland is the one that works without fuss. You can deposit a pound via debit card, Apple Pay, or even bank transfer if you’re in no rush. The deposits hit instantly except for the bank route, which takes a few days. So if you want to play right now, stick with the card or Apple Pay. Unibet technically accepts £1 deposits too, but only through bank transfers. That means you’re waiting. The transaction clears when it clears. It’s a valid option if you’re planning ahead, but not if you’re sitting there with a spare pound and an itch to play.

What You Can Actually Play for a Pound

You’re not winning a jackpot with a single quid. But you can have fun. Penny slots let you bet as low as one pence per spin, stretching that pound into dozens of plays. Look for games like Space Stacks, Merlin and the Ice Queen Morgana, or Crystal Furnace. Bingo tickets at some sites cost a pound, giving you a full game’s worth of entertainment. Table games like blackjack and roulette have tables with minimum bets of ten or twenty pence, so you can get a few rounds in. Video poker at Lottomart is another solid option, and they even have a live version if you want the social buzz without the high stakes.

The Practical Takeaway

If you’re going to play with a pound, use a debit card – it’s instant, accepted everywhere, and works for all bonuses. Skip the bank transfer unless you’re patient. Read the wagering requirements before you accept any bonus; a 200x playthrough on a quid means you need to bet £200 before you can withdraw. And don’t expect to cash out big. The real win here is the control you get – you can dip into a new casino, test the games, and walk away having spent less than a coffee. That’s a gamble worth taking.
